OverviewThis narrative of how stringed instruments evolved in Western Europe focuses on names, playing styles, sizes, tunings, stringings and construction basics, within a chronological framework. The influences of previous instruments and technological developments are outlined. New insights are offered into the early development of most of the instruments, including viols, guitars and violins. Some of the conclusions are likely to differ from the expectations of many current early-music specialists.
